Neighborhood Overview
Tichenor Middle School is situated in the heart of Erlanger, a suburban city in Northern Kentucky, part of the larger Cincinnati metropolitan area. The school is easily accessible via Interstate 75 and Interstate 71, which merge in the nearby Florence area, providing direct routes north to Cincinnati and south towards Lexington. Bartlett Avenue is a main artery in Erlanger, ensuring straightforward navigation to the school. Parking is primarily available in lots directly adjacent to the school buildings and athletic fields. For those flying in, the Cincinnati/Northern Kentucky International Airport (CVG) is conveniently located less than 10 miles northwest of Erlanger, typically a 15-20 minute drive depending on traffic. Public transportation options are limited in this suburban area, making rideshares or personal vehicles the most practical modes of transport. Plan to arrive at least 30-45 minutes prior to any scheduled event to account for parking and navigating to your specific location within the school complex.
Where to Stay
Erlanger offers a range of hotel accommodations, with several clusters located along the I-75 corridor in Erlanger and neighboring Florence, a short drive from Tichenor Middle School. Most hotels are situated within a 5-10 minute drive of the school, making them convenient bases for teams and families. While the immediate area around the school is largely residential and commercial, the adjacent Erlanger town center offers some dining and essential services within a short drive. Demand for lodging can increase significantly during school sporting events, tournaments, or larger community gatherings, so booking accommodations well in advance is highly recommended. Utilizing hotel booking sites with map filters can help identify properties closest to the school, and considering flexible dates can sometimes offer better rates. Many visitors opt for hotels in Florence or Union, which provide a wider selection and are only a brief commute away.

Weather & Seasons
Winter
Winter in Erlanger typically brings cool to cold temperatures, with average highs in the 40s Fahrenheit. Expect frosty mornings and the possibility of snow or ice, though heavy accumulations are infrequent. Layers are essential for comfort, including a warm coat, hat, and gloves for outdoor events. Indoor activities become more appealing, and travel might require checking road conditions.
Spring & early summer
Spring sees temperatures gradually warming into the 60s and 70s Fahrenheit, with increasing sunshine but also frequent rain showers. Early summer continues this trend with warmer days, often reaching the 80s. Lightweight jackets and an umbrella are practical additions to your packing list. Outdoor events are pleasant, but be prepared for variable weather that can shift quickly.
Mid-summer
July and August are typically the hottest months, with temperatures frequently climbing into the 80s and 90s Fahrenheit, accompanied by high humidity. Staying hydrated is crucial, and seeking shade or air-conditioned spaces is recommended during peak daylight hours. Light, breathable clothing is best, and sunscreen is a must for any outdoor activity.
Fall season
Fall brings crisp, pleasant temperatures, with highs often in the 60s and 70s Fahrenheit, gradually cooling into the 50s. This season is ideal for outdoor sports and activities. Layers are again beneficial, as mornings can be cool and afternoons mild. Enjoying the changing foliage is a seasonal bonus, making it a great time to visit.
Rain & snow
Rain is possible year-round, though more frequent in spring and summer. Snow is less common but can occur during winter months, occasionally causing travel disruptions. Always check local weather forecasts and road conditions before traveling. Indoor facilities like the library or nearby malls serve as excellent rainy-day or snow-day alternatives for downtime.
